Welcomed Surrender

In sanctums aisle came welcomed surrender,
blessed with toast from Heaven's sweetest wine
Vineyards' harvest brimming vessels filled,
paid homage to nuptials woven vine

Vowed hearts bestowed each to others keep;
nights embrace unknown to succumbing still
Loves' absence to falter prevails the years;
vestige of fallen trestles' presence nil

Beneath veils' flow smiled my founding dream;
mirrored facet from the morning star
Roses aligned near petal strewn way,
bowed to the image of their beauties par

Morns' resembled mist moistened your kiss,
offered with closing of liquid jade eyes
Timeless recall paints elegant views,
tinged in shades of everlasting ties

In sanctums aisle came welcomed surrender,
blessed with toast from Heaven's sweetest wine
Vessels brimmed in hearts contented fill,
forever, our love is a woven vine
